Our Oxford Site is the perfect place to explore the University City. It is just over a mile from the centre, yet it is still a great site for wildlife, especially the cheeky resident squirrel. Join the locals and bring your bike or take advantage of the good public transport.
The following facilities are available at this site; Club Service Pitch, Club Standard Pitch, Storage facilities, Grassy site, Open (unsheltered), Toilets, Hot showers, Washbasins, Electric razor sockets, Chemical toilet disposal point, Drinking water, Laundry facilities, Dishwashing facilities, Ice pack freezing facility, Bottled gas, Dogs welcome.
Be wary if you're driving to the Site from the A34 - you need to come off at the Hinksey Hill interchange (A4144, A423/A4142). The entrance is on the left of the Go Outdoors leisure store (a large blue building), 75m before the traffic lights. Being a great Site for seeing the University City means Oxford suffers from a little more noise than most Club sites.
